public void SetData(Dictionary <int, StItem> items, List <StAnswer> answers, Dictionary <String, String> demogInfo, StNormAuto norm) { mItems = items; mAnswers = answers; mDemogInfo = demogInfo; mNorm = norm; }
public AroraReport(int DemogLen, int TestCount, StNormAuto Norm, int UserIndex = -1) { mUI = new ReportUI(this); mReader = new AroraAppendableGeneralReader(DemogLen, TestCount, Norm);//norm for offset count mReader.Fetch(UserIndex); mTotalPages = mReader.mNorm.Dims.Count; mNorm = Norm; }
public AroraAppendableGeneralReader(int DemogLen, int TestCount, StNormAuto Norm) { mFetch = new TabFetcher(AroraCore.OUT_PATH, "\\t"); mDemogLen = DemogLen; mTestCount = TestCount; mNorm = Norm; }
public ConfigCollection() { //demog structure Lithopone.FileReader.DemogXmlReader rd = new FileReader.DemogXmlReader(); mDemogLines = rd.GetDemogItems(Lib.DemogFileName); //test structure TestXmlReader xmlReader = new TestXmlReader(); xmlReader.Begin(Lib.TestFileName); mTestInfo = xmlReader.GetHeader(); xmlReader.Finish(); //norm structure mNorms = nf.GetNorm(); }